Hiking around Rimaucourt, located in the Haute-Marne department of France, offers diverse natural landscapes. The region features a mix of tranquil reserves, geological formations, and varied hiking trails. Terrain includes forests, rivers, meadows, and wooded valleys, with some areas presenting circular ravines and elevated viewpoints. The area provides options for different fitness levels, from easy paths to moderate ascents.

Le Cul du Cerf is a picturesque site which offers a spectacular view of a natural phenomenon of erosion. It is a circular ravine 200 meters wide and 65 meters deep, where the Manoise River emerges from a chasm and flows into a wooded valley. There you can admire the flora and fauna of the forest, as well as the ponds and waterfalls of the region.

Château de Reynel is an 18th century castle that was built on the site of a medieval fortress. You can admire its elegant architecture, its rich collection of paintings and its panoramic view of the valley and the lake. The castle is open to the public from June to September, and you can take a guided tour to learn more about its history and its owners. The castle is surrounded by a magnificent park which offers various hiking and exploring trails. You can enjoy the nature and tranquility of this place, and discover some interesting features such as statues, balustrades and an old chapel. The park also has an arboretum and a remarkable garden that showcases different styles and eras. Reynel Castle is a perfect destination for a relaxing and cultural hike.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many hiking trails are available around Rimaucourt?

There are over 10 hiking trails around Rimaucourt, offering a variety of experiences. These include 4 easy routes, 6 moderate routes, and 1 difficult route, catering to different fitness levels and preferences.

Are there easy hiking trails suitable for families or beginners in Rimaucourt?

Yes, Rimaucourt offers several easy hiking trails perfect for families or beginners. For instance, the Reynel door loop from Reynel is an easy 5.8 km path, and the Château de Morteau loop from Champ Maizey is another easy option spanning about 7 km.

What kind of natural landscapes can I expect to see while hiking near Rimaucourt?

Hiking near Rimaucourt will immerse you in diverse natural landscapes. The region is characterized by dense woodlands, tranquil river valleys (including the Sueurre and Manoise rivers), and geological curiosities like the circular ravine known as Le cul de Cerf. You'll find a mix of forests, meadows, and varied terrain typical of the Haute-Marne department.

Are there any circular hiking routes in the Rimaucourt area?

Yes, many of the trails around Rimaucourt are designed as circular routes. Popular options include the moderate Le cul de Cerf — loop from Orquevaux, which explores the Orquevaux Managed Biological Reserve, and the Château de Reynel — loop, offering views of the historic château.

What are some notable landmarks or points of interest to look out for on hikes?

While hiking, you might encounter historical elements like the Château de Reynel, visible from the Château de Reynel — loop. The region's history with watermills and forges along the Sueurre river also hints at interesting historical remnants. Further afield, the impressive Viaduc de Chaumont, with its dedicated footpath, offers breathtaking views.

Are there any longer, more challenging hikes for experienced trekkers?

While most routes are easy to moderate, the region does offer longer options. The Château de Reynel — loop is a moderate 12.2 km trail with an elevation gain of 187 meters, providing a more extended challenge. There is also one designated difficult route in the area for those seeking a greater adventure.

What is the best time of year to go hiking in Rimaucourt?

The Haute-Marne department, where Rimaucourt is located, offers pleasant hiking conditions through much of the year. Spring and autumn provide comfortable temperatures and beautiful scenery with blooming flowers or vibrant foliage. Summer is also suitable, especially for riverside walks, while winter hikes can offer a tranquil, snow-dusted landscape, though some paths might be more challenging.

Are there opportunities for wildlife spotting while hiking in Rimaucourt?

The varied natural landscapes, including dense woodlands and river ecosystems, provide a habitat for diverse wildlife. Keep an eye out for local birds, small mammals, and other forest creatures, especially in quieter areas like the Orquevaux Managed Biological Reserve.

What are some nearby attractions or natural sites worth visiting in the broader region?

Beyond Rimaucourt, the Haute-Marne department boasts several significant natural and historical attractions. You could visit the vast Lac du Der-Chantecoq, Europe's largest artificial lake, or explore the scenic Cotes de Meuse. The Champagne and Burgundy Forests National Park, including sites like Auberive Abbey, also offers extensive natural beauty and historical interest.
